Hristijan Mickoski must apologise, PM Zhelyazkov says in Rome

Hristijan Mickoski
Photo: BGNES

“Prime Minister Hristijan Mickoski’s narrative will be left to those familiar with Aesop’s fables,” Bulgarian Prime Minister Rosen Zhelyazkov commented in Rome, where he attended the Fourth Ukraine Recovery Conference. “North Macedonia must adhere to the consensus reached in 2022 and fulfill the commitments it has made,” Zhelyazkov added.


His remarks were in response to Mickoski’s offensive language directed at the Bulgarian foreign minister.

“Our colleague Mickoski must find a way to apologize,” Zhelyazkov advised.
